CIBC FirstCaribbean International Bank (Jamaica) has led the way with a number of innovations that are taking hold on the Jamaican banking landscape. It was the first to offer a Visa Debit Card and to lead the way with a mobile banking offering that allows its customers to monitor their accounts on their handsets.
The bank has not trumpeted its successes, opting to remain low key. Last year Nigel Holness took over from the esteemed Clovis Metcalfe as managing director. What are his thoughts on the last year as managing director and how does he regard the performance of the bank?

Speaking with Caribbean Business Report from the headquarters of CIBC FirstCaribbean (Jamaica) at Knutsford Boulevard, New Kingston, Holness said: "This last year has been one of excitement. Yes, there have been challenges, particularly with the global economy and the downturn here at home, but with the team that I have around me who are doing a great job of driving the customer experience, the sky is the limit. We are leading the way in Jamaica in introducing innovative products and services."
Holness has taken over at a time when the bank has undergone a rebranding exercise. It has returned to its roots and has re-established a distinct connection to CIBC.
Holness explained: "We are connected to CIBC which is the fourth largest bank in the world. We are lifting the FirstCaribbean brand together with that of CIBC. Many people associate FirstCaribbean with CIBC, but the fact is the service remains the same. What is critical for us is customer loyalty.
"Recently we had an event for Peter McConnell who has now retired from our board of directors. His family has been banking with us from 1921 — that's 90 years. At a reception we had for him he read some notes from his father's journal about the first loan he got from us (back in 1921), and the manager's response to that loan. That kind of service has not changed. Peter (McConnell) explained to us that he operated the first drive-in teller for CIBC which was an innovation we introduced to the Jamaican market."
